VZ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review

3,262 of the 8,136 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Verizon (VZ)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$141B — up 23% from $115B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 346 funds opened new VZ positions and 130 closed out — a net gain of 216 holders — while 1,318 added to existing stakes and 1,337 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$420M. The largest seller was State Street, cutting an estimated $375M.
